Since he first came to England back in January this year on-loan from Sparta Prague, Martin Dubravka has been a revelation in the Northeast. The 29-year-old came in as an unheard of shot-stopper when the Magpies weren’t calling out for a new ‘keeper, however, the Slovakian has usurped both Karl Darlow and Rob Elliot will ease as he’s become a hero at St James Park.

Despite the fact that Newcastle United are currently 17th having won for the first time on Saturday, Dubravka has the 4th most clean sheets of every Premier League goalkeeper, more than Hugo Lloris and David De Gea, and is only behind Ederson, Alisson and Kepa Arrizabalaga. The next step for Newcastle will be for Rafa Benitez to try and build on Dubravka’s stability at the back and be more clinical going forward.

Three of the Slovakian’s shutouts have come during 0-0 draws, however, if The Geordies were able to turn those three draws into wins then they’d be sitting pretty on 12 points and 13th in the table. Instead, an inability to find the net has let down the defensive stars at the club and they find themselves in a relegation battle. Dubravka and co face Burnley and West Ham in their next two matches either side of the international break and if they can keep up their defensive dominance and improve going forward then they should survive comfortably this season.
